Luma AI's New Ray3 Video Generator Can 'Think' Before Creating
Luma AI's Ray3 model offers paid Adobe Firefly users unlimited AI-assisted video generation for two weeks, enhancing creative workflows with cinematic-quality, high dynamic range output.
- Today, Adobe Inc. revealed that Luma AI's Ray3 model is available in the Adobe Firefly app, intensifying competition for cinematic-level AI video.
- Over the past year, many big tech firms released AI video models, fueling competition; Adobe Inc. and Luma AI aim to make AI-generated cinematic video more realistic and integrate partner models into Firefly for studios and filmmakers.
- Technically, Ray3 supports professional HDR formats and 4K rendering for high-end projects, featuring true 10-, 12-, and 16-bit HDR ACES2065-1 EXR format and workflow tools like on-screen notes and doodle-based motion inputs.
- To help users get started, Adobe is offering unlimited free Ray3 generations to paid Firefly plan customers and Creative Cloud Pro plan subscribers until October 1, with exclusivity on Firefly and Dream Machine for the next two weeks.
- With short‑form video dominating attention, Ray3 arrives as studios weigh AI tools; Hollywood studios and filmmakers may use Ray3 to generate in‑screen video and reduce production costs amid concerns from artists filing class‑action lawsuits and 139 million Instagram Reels viewed every minute.

Adobe Firefly incorporates a novelty that promises to change the way creators develop audiovisual content: the integration of Luma AI’s Ray3 artificial intelligence video model. This collaboration places Adobe as the model’s exclusive launch partner, which will be available on Firefly for two weeks prior to its general release.
